Philadelphia flight not free from turbulence
I had the honor of being at Independence Hall in Philadelphia on July Fourth. It was a moving experience. Our enthusiastic National Park Service guide gave us all the salient historical details and then threw in interesting tidbits, such as the fact that the youngest signer of the Declaration of Independence was 26 and the oldest — acclaimed kite-flier Ben Franklin — was 70. The guide also reminded us of Franklin’s comment as he added his signature and anticipated the Fourth of July barbecues to come: "Give me good potato salad or give me death!”
